Vertical Turbine Pumps

Vertical turbine pumps are engineered to move water or other fluids from deep underground sources to surface levels. They ensure effective and reliable fluid transport for various industrial applications.

Vertical Turbine Pump Buying Guide

When selecting a surplus vertical turbine pump, consider the following factors to ensure optimal performance and compatibility with your needs:

Choose a pump with suitable flow and head specifications that match your operational requirements. Check the material of construction to ensure it can handle the fluid and environmental conditions. Verify the pump’s condition, including any wear and repair history, to assess its longevity. Determine if the pump’s capacity and size fit your existing infrastructure and system needs. Confirm the availability of parts and service support for maintenance and repairs.

Frequently Asked Questions

What are vertical turbine pumps used for?
Vertical turbine pumps are used for transporting water or other fluids from deep sources, such as wells, to the surface for industrial processes.
What should I consider when buying a surplus vertical turbine pump?
When buying a surplus pump, verify its condition, compatibility with your system, and any maintenance records available.
How do vertical turbine pumps operate?
They operate by using a series of impellers to lift fluid through a vertical column, efficiently moving it from deep sources to surface levels.
